Focus ActivityStudents guess the topic of the news. These guesses are meant to lead the students into the main topic of listening.a. The news is about the weather.b. The news is about an accident in the centre of the town.c. The news is about the weather and an accident in the town.Key:The news is about the weather and an accident in the town.While listening 1st listeningStudents listen to check their guess. The teacher invites students to justify the appropriate answer. 2nd Listening
The teacher plays CD again and asks students to do the true false task. The teacher may play CD again if needed.a. The news started at 12 oclock.b. Chaos in the North has been caused by heavy rain.c. The rain started falling early this morning.d. People are advised to go downtown in public transport.e. Schools in rural areas and in the town are closed.f. The weather forecast predicts the weather tomorrow.key:a. False: 01 oclock.b. Truec. False: rain has been falling since yesterday.d. True: heavy rains caused great difficulty for motorists and pedestrians.e. False: In the town, schools are open as usual.f. False: it is going to rain all day and at least for two more days. 3rd Listening
Students listen again and correct their choices. Post ListeningIn groups, students write a report on a recent event or piece of news. Once groups have finished, the teacher corrects their reports and invites them to read the report to the whole class.Q/A
